Inspection
1. |
Check that the red light flickers when the door lock or unlock
button is pressed on the transmitter.
|
2. |
Remove the battery (A) and check voltage if the red light doesn't
flicker.
|
3. |
Insert the battery (A) into the tester (09954-2P100).
|
4. |
Push the test button and If "0.00" is displayed on screen, it
means that the battery voltage is 2V or less.
|
5. |
If "L" is displayed on screen, it means that the battery is low
power and it needs to replace.
|
6. |
To prevent the discharge of electricity, turn the tester power
off.
|
7. |
Replace the transmitter battery with a new one, if voltage is
low power then try to lock and unlock the doors with the transmitter
by pressing the lock or unlock button five or six times.
|
8. |
If the doors lock and unlock, the transmitter is O.K, but if the
doors don't lock and unlock, register the transmitter code, then try
to lock and unlock the doors.
|
9. |
If the doors lock and unlock, the transmitter is O.K, but if the
doors don't lock and unlock, replace the transmitter.
|
Transmitter Code Registration (Using GDS)
1. |
Connect the DLC cable of GDS to the data link connector (16 pins)
in driver side crash pad lower panel, turn the power on GDS.
|
2. |
Select the vehicle model and then select "CODE SAVING"
|
3. |
After selecting "CODE SAVING" menu, button "ENTER" key, then the
screen will be shown as below.
|
4. |
After removing the ignition key from key cylinder, push "ENTER"
key to proceed to the next mode for code saving. Follow steps 1 to 4
and then code saving is completed.
|
